SPRING, TX -- City Place Dia de los Muertos festivities are open to the public and free to attend.

North Houston business and leisure destination City Place is making preparations to host its fourth annual Dia de los Muertos celebration. The weekend kicks off on November 1 with a complimentary Pix on the Plaza screening of popular Disney movie, Coco, about a young musician on a journey to unlock the story behind his family history. The alfresco movie night starts at 6:45 pm and includes complimentary popcorn while supplies last. Low-profile chairs, hand-held coolers and blankets are welcome.

The free to attend family fun continues on November 2 from 4-8 pm, when a ceremonial altar will be unveiled for the community to recognize their dearly departed loved ones. Guests can shop at the open-air Mercado, where a variety of curated vendors and artisans will showcase an assortment of upscale accessories, art, jewelry, clothing, handcrafted ornaments and more. Hands-on craft stations will allow guests to create flower crowns, pinatas and papel picado (traditional decorative folk art). Visitors will also enjoy activities such as face painting and a loteria, a popular Mexican game of chance. Food trucks will be onsite with various offerings. Lively performances will take center stage with a headline show from Bidi Bidi Banda, Austin’s first all-star Selena Tribute band, in addition to traditional mariachis and pop-up dance performances.
